Output ff94c01fc6ccad67328a6bd315e5af7fd66a1edf4a623df9cb2ce0aa0ba220b3:0

value
575566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bcdab74ac60d37fb117a8dfabb93894fdf5ebb3065bb928d3451326b4a19eb4e
address
bc1phndtwjkxp5mlkyt63hathyuffl04awesvkae9rf52yexkjsead8qdevmwx
transaction
ff94c01fc6ccad67328a6bd315e5af7fd66a1edf4a623df9cb2ce0aa0ba220b3
spent
true